There are no saltwater plants, its all algae, both micro & macro.

An algae bloom is normal at the end of the initial cycle period. Usually this is the time to start doing routine water changes. At the end of my cycle, I did a 50% change then proceeded with 10-15% weekly thereafter. If the algae starts to take over the tank weeks down the road, then steps need to be taken, such as insuring good water quality (ie low nitrates and phosphates) etc.
